To ensure that journal entries have been recorded and posted correctly, small businesses use the trial balance accounting method to double-check account balances for a given time period. A trial balance ensures that the debit and credit balances in the ledger accounts match. Cash runway tells you how many months your startup can operate at its current burn rate before needing additional funding. Closely monitoring these two metrics together helps you anticipate your funding needs and make strategic adjustments to extend your runway. Startups in the tech industry are highly vulnerable to market fluctuations, so financial planning is crucial. Maintaining a strong cash reserve, securing diversified revenue streams, and reducing unnecessary overhead expenses can help a company stay afloat during uncertain times. Strategic budgeting, clear financial forecasting, and understanding burn rate dynamics are key components of accounting for startups that want to remain resilient in challenging economic conditions.
